This week and for the next year, ‘Last Chance Joe’ license plates will be available to drivers at the local DMV. The plates will cost $62 and the museum will receive $20 for each plate sold.
Museum staff says the money raised from the plates will pay for museum expenses and ‘Last Chance Joe’ restoration.
‘Last Chance Joe’ was the face of the Nugget for more than 50 years. In 2014, the 36-foot-tall miner was moved to the Sparks Museum.
